site stats

Change table schema postgres

WebFeb 4, 2008 · Below is our attempt to fill in these missing parts for pre-PostgreSQL 8.1 installs. PostgreSQL 8.1 should use the ALTER TABLE SET SCHEMA approach … WebAlter tables. If you need to change the schema of an existing table in PostgreSQL, you can use the ALTER TABLE command. The ALTER TABLE command is very similar to the CREATE TABLE command, but operates on an existing table. Alter table syntax. The basic syntax for modifying tables in PostgreSQL looks like this:

PostgreSQL Table Schema Guide to PostgreSQL Table Schema …

WebPostgres Pro Enterprise Postgres Pro Standard Cloud Solutions Postgres Extensions. Resources Blog Documentation Webinars Videos Presentations. ... Logical replication - schema change not invalidating the relation cache: Date: January 6 02:02:31: Msg-id: [email protected] Whole thread Raw: WebDec 6, 2024 · If you can query the tablenames in your schema, you can generate the queries to ALTER table ownership. For example: select 'ALTER TABLE ' t.tablename … how to tag on youtube video https://familie-ramm.org

PostgreSQL Change owner of all tables under a specific …

Webname. The name (possibly schema-qualified) of an existing table to alter. If ONLY is specified, only that table is altered. If ONLY is not specified, the table and all its descendant tables (if any) are updated.* can be appended to the table name to indicate that descendant tables are to be altered, but in the current version, this is the default behavior. Web3 hours ago · 0. I want to dump only part of the table (filtered using SELECT) with schema so I can take the dump and import it to other database without the need to create the schema first. COPY command allows me to dump part of the table but without the schema. pg_dump on the other hand allows me to dump the entire table with schema but I … how to tag on tik tok

Moving tables from one schema to another - Postgres OnLine …

Category:Re: Logical replication - schema change not invalidating the …

Tags:Change table schema postgres

Change table schema postgres

How to change schema of multiple PostgreSQL tables in …

WebOct 20, 2016 · 34. I have a PostgreSQL 9.1 database with 100 or so tables that were loaded into the 'public' schema. I would like to move those tables (but not all of the … WebMar 1, 2024 · GRANT CREATE ON SCHEMA public TO airflow; Important updates for Postgres 15! The release notes: Remove PUBLIC creation permission on the public schema (Noah Misch) And: Change the owner of the public schema to be the new pg_database_owner role (Noah Misch) You can still change that any way you like. It's …

Change table schema postgres

Did you know?

WebAs Tom Lane and David Fetter have noted - 8.1 and above introduced a ALTER TABLE name SET SCHEMA new_schema command, which is documented in 8.1-8.3 ALTER TABLE docs so the below code is unnecessary for PostgreSQL 8.1 and above. Fiddling directly with the raw PG Catalog is generally a bad thing to do and its very likely we … WebApr 26, 2024 · To rename a table already created in PostgreSQL, we can use the ALTER statement that tends to make changes or modify some object already made inside the …

WebApr 12, 2024 · The pt-online-schema-change tool also provides a third option, “auto.”. When selecting “auto,” the tool makes a decision between “rebuild_constraints” and “drop_swap” based on the size of the child table involved in the alteration process. This allows for flexibility in choosing the appropriate option based on the specific ... WebFeb 9, 2024 · Description. CREATE SCHEMA enters a new schema into the current database. The schema name must be distinct from the name of any existing schema in the current database. A schema is essentially a namespace: it contains named objects (tables, data types, functions, and operators) whose names can duplicate those of other objects …

WebAug 28, 2024 · PostgreSQL has A ALTER SCHEMA statement that is used to modify the definition of an existing schema. Syntax: ALTER SCHEMA schema_name ACTION … Webname. The name (possibly schema-qualified) of an existing table to alter. If ONLY is specified, only that table is altered. If ONLY is not specified, the table and all its …

WebIntroduction to PostgreSQL Table Schema. PostgreSQL provides the functionality to see the detail structure of table or database we called as schema. Table schema is helpful to see important information about the table. We can refer to the schema as a collection of tables schema also consists of view, indexes, sequence, data type, function, and ...

WebTo change the structure of an existing table, you use PostgreSQL ALTER TABLE statement. The following illustrates the basic syntax of the ALTER TABLE statement: … readworks a bad robotWebOct 26, 2024 · PostgreSQL offers an “ALTER SCHEMA” statement that is used to modify the schema’s definition, such as altering the schema’s owner, renaming a schema, and … how to tag people in google sheetsWebJun 27, 2024 · Finally, alter the owner of the schema accordingly. The pattern for altering the owner of the schema exist as follows : alter schema schema_name owner to user_name. The following is th execution of the command according to the above pattern : db_app=# alter schema customer owner to admin; ALTER SCHEMA sak_djpk=# readworks a bird came down the walk answersWebBelow is the syntax : 1. Alter table to change the name of the table. Alter table name_of_table RENAME TO new_name_of_table; 2. Alter table to add a column. Alter table name_of_table ADD name_of_column … readworks a kid in a candy store answer keyWebFeb 9, 2024 · 5.9.5. The System Catalog Schema. In addition to public and user-created schemas, each database contains a pg_catalog schema, which contains the system tables and all the built-in data types, functions, and operators. pg_catalog is always effectively part of the search path. If it is not named explicitly in the path then it is implicitly ... how to tag other streamers on twitchWebMay 2, 2016 · Then I created a table and the table owner was automatically ink, not sys. We recently have switched databases from Oracle to Postgres. Here I log in as "postgres", then I switch to the "ink" schema with: set search_path to 'ink'; Then I create a table and the table owner automatically is postgres, not ink. So this behavior is reverse. readworks a dangerous game answersWebSep 4, 2024 · なお検証はできていませんが、postgresql 11以降ではalter table ~ not null defaultを利用した場合でも、レコードのデフォルト値更新は遅延されるようになっているので、安全にalterできるようです。 書き込み頻度の高いテーブルにalter tableを行う 起こり … readworks a fight for hurling answer key